It can be difficult to accurately detect AI-written content, as it is often designed to mimic human writing. However, there are a few indicators that could suggest a piece of content was written by AI:

1. Unnatural language: AI-written content may have awkward phrasing, unnatural syntax, or other language errors that are not typically seen in human writing.

2. Lack of personal touch: AI-written content may lack the personal touch and emotional depth that is commonly seen in human writing.

3. Inconsistencies: AI-written content may display inconsistencies in tone, style, and topic transitions.

4. Unusual word choices: AI-written content may use uncommon or unusual word choices or phrasing that is not typically seen in human writing.

5. Use of technical jargon or terminology: AI-written content may rely heavily on technical jargon or industry-specific terminology.

6. Excessive repetition: AI-written content may repeat the same ideas or phrases multiple times, which can indicate a lack of originality or creativity.

Overall, while these indicators can help in detecting AI-written content, it is important to note that AI technology is constantly improving, and some AI-generated content may be difficult to distinguish from human writing.
